function verif_formulaire(frm, civilite, prenom, nom, email, telephone_fixe, entreprise, ville, secteur, effectif, ca, web_site, message)
{
var chkZ;

if((civilite == 1) && (frm.civilite.value == ""))  {
   alert("Merci de  saisir votre civilité.");
   frm.civilite.focus();
   return false;
  }

if((prenom == 1) && (frm.prenom.value == ""))  {
   alert("Merci de saisir votre prénom.");
   frm.prenom.focus();
   return false;
  }

if((nom == 1) && (frm.nom.value == ""))  {
   alert("Merci de  saisir votre nom.");
   frm.nom.focus();
   return false;
  }

if((email == 1) && (frm.email.value == ""))  {
   alert("Merci de  saisir votre email.");
   frm.email.focus();
   return false;
  }
  
if((email == 1) && (!VerifMail(frm.email.value))) {
   alert("Votre adresse électronique n'est pas valide.");
   frm.email.focus();
   return false;
  }

if((telephone_fixe == 1) && (frm.telephone_fixe.value == ""))  {
   alert("Merci de  saisir votre numéro de téléphone.");
   frm.telephone_fixe.focus();
   return false;
  }
else {
	if (telephone_fixe == 1) {
		 chkZ = 1;
		 for(i=0;i<frm.telephone_fixe.value.length;i++)
		   if(frm.telephone_fixe.value.charAt(i) < "0"
		   || frm.telephone_fixe.value.charAt(i) > "9")
		     chkZ = -1;
		 if(chkZ == -1) {
		   alert("Merci de saisir un numéro de téléphone valide.");
		   frm.telephone_fixe.focus();
		   return false;
		  }
		}
	}

if((entreprise == 1) && (frm.entreprise.value == ""))  {
   alert("Merci de saisir la raison sociale de votre entreprise.");
   frm.entreprise.focus();
   return false;
  }

if((ville == 1) && (frm.ville.value == ""))  {
   alert("Merci de saisir votre ville.");
   frm.ville.focus();
   return false;
  }

if((secteur == 1) && (frm.secteur.value == ""))  {
   alert("Merci de saisir votre secteur.");
   frm.secteur.focus();
   return false;
  }

if((effectif == 1) && (frm.effectif.value == ""))  {
   alert("Merci de saisir votre effectif.");
   frm.effectif.focus();
   return false;
  }

if((ca == 1) && (frm.ca.value == ""))  {
   alert("Merci de saisir votre chiffre d'affaires.");
   frm.ca.focus();
   return false;
  }

if((web_site == 1) && (frm.web_site.value == ""))  {
   alert("Merci de saisir l'adresse de votre site web.");
   frm.web_site.focus();
   return false;
  }

if((message == 1) && (frm.message.value == ""))  {
   alert("Merci de saisir votre message.");
   frm.message.focus();
   return false;
  }

return true;
}

function VerifMail(mail)
{
valide1 = false;

for(var j=1;j<(mail.length);j++){
	if(mail.charAt(j)=='@'){
		if(j<(mail.length-4)){
			for(var k=j;k<(mail.length-2);k++){
				if(mail.charAt(k)=='.') valide1=true;
			}
		}
	}
}
return valide1;
}
